How they compare
Indonesia currently reports 3.6% against 1.8% in Colombia, a difference of 1.8%.
That makes Indonesia's figure about 2.0 times Colombia's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 9 shared years of data; in 2014 it was Colombia ahead.
Colombia ranks 30th and Indonesia ranks 27th of 35 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Colombia averaged higher in 1 and Indonesia in 1.
